•
Wake by WiGig Dock
Values:
Disabled
, Enabled
Description: Enable or disable the wake-up function of the ThinkPad WiGig Dock. If you select
Enabled
,
the battery life might become shorter.
•
Wireless Auto Disconnection
Values:
Disabled
, Enabled
Description: Enable or disable the wireless automatic disconnection function. This is selectable only
when an Ethernet cable is connected to the Ethernet connector on your computer. If you select
Enabled
,
Wireless LAN and WiGig signals are automatically turned off whenever an Ethernet cable is connected.
Note:
Ethernet connection by the USB Ethernet adapter is not supported by this feature.
•
MAC address Pass Through
Values:
Disabled
, Enabled
Description: The MAC address for the LENOVO USB Dock will be changed to the Internal MAC address.
If you select
Disabled
, the MAC address for the LENOVO USB Dock will remain the original MAC
address. If you select
Enabled
, the MAC address for the LENOVO USB Dock will be changed to the
Internal MAC address.
USB
•
USB UEFI BIOS Support
Values: Disabled,
Enabled
Description: Enable or disable the boot support for USB storage devices.
•
Always On USB
Values: Disabled,
Enabled
Description: Select
Enabled
to charge devices through the Always On USB connectors even when the
computer is turned off, in sleep mode, or in hibernation mode.
•
Charge in Battery Mode
Values:
Disabled
, Enabled
Description: This option is supported only when
Always On USB
is enabled. Select
Enabled
to charge
devices through the Always On USB connector even when the computer is in hibernation mode, or
powered off and in battery operation.
Keyboard/Mouse
•
TrackPoint
Values: Disabled,
Enabled
Description: Enable or disable the built-in TrackPoint pointing device.
